Abstract
A cable conduit electrical box including a base having at least one opening for receiving a cable conduit, a cover removably attachable to the base, and an adapter removably positioned on the base or the cover for sealing the at least one opening around the cable conduit. The adapter may be secured with mounting tabs or mounting apertures.

(12) Adapters 22 may be sized to suitably fit within the area of base openings 18, with the adapters 22 having a body 24 and conduit openings 26 of various sizes. The adapters may further include at least one or more adapter tabs 28 and one or more of the adapter tabs 28 may include a locking tab 30. In one implementation, the cable conduit electrical box 10 includes a plurality of adapters 22 with different sizes of conduit openings 26 that are arranged to fit various width and height of cable conduit 16. Further, adapters 22 may include blanks or other suitable filler components that do not include conduit openings 26 for base openings 18 which are not receiving cable conduit 16 to advantageously seal the cable conduit electrical box 10.

(14) As can be envisioned from the illustrations, it is advantageous to first secure base 12 to a wall structure and then cut cable conduit 16 to the appropriate length so that it terminates within base opening 18. With the terminating end of cable conduit 16 positioned within base opening 18, the user then selects an adapter 22 having an appropriately sized adapter conduit opening 26 and the adapter 22 is secured within cover 14 and cover track slot 34 until adapter locking tab 30 engages track locking tab 36. The user will also insert any suitable blank adapters, or those adapters without adapter conduit openings 26 therein and locate the blank adapters in any cover track slots 34 which are not receiving cable conduit 16. The user may then secure the cover 14 to base 12 to thereby enclose the cable conduit electrical box 10 with cable conduit 16 appropriately positioned within the base 12 and cover 14 and sealed from the surrounding environment as can also be seen in
